Application Logistics
•Complete the Kean University application via Common App or kean.edu
•After academic materials are reviewed, eligible applicants receive an invitation to schedule a music audition before a final decision
•Video portfolio/audition content is submitted through the Kean University Application Portal/CougarApp; Common App students receive account setup instructions
•In-person auditions are scheduled through the Department of Music
•Admitted students take placement tests in music theory, sight singing/ear training, and class piano at entry - for course placement only, not admission
•An optional music history placement test is available to test out of the music history survey
Enrollment
•Rolling admissions with April 30 priority deadline
Program Requirements
•Full-time music majors participate in two ensembles each semester (one primary by performance area, one secondary by advisement)
•Perform in at least one student recital per semester and take a jury (performance exam) at the end of each semester
